		<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>True, customization of the manager in MODx can only be done with the managermanager plugin ( <a href="http://bit.ly/bjHaZK" target="_blank">http://bit.ly/bjHaZK</a> ) , which in fact is nothing more than some jquery dom manipulation, which i think works, but is not as solid as having full access to the generation of the administrative backend.  </p>
<p>About the templating engine: this was one of the main reasons for me to get started with MODx. You actually can have {if then} conditionals if you install PHx ( <a href="http://bit.ly/dBg1t7" target="_blank">http://bit.ly/dBg1t7</a> docs: <a href="http://bit.ly/csGgva" target="_blank">http://bit.ly/csGgva</a> ). PHx is very extensible: just create phx:functioname snippets with any kind of logic in it, then use it [*longtitle:functioname*]</p>
